Box in the Shape of a Cartouche
The cartouche, an oval outline symbolic of the sun’s circuit, enclosed both the throne and birth names of the king. The hieroglyphs on the lid record the latter and his customary epithet, “Tutankhamun, Ruler of the Upper Egyptian Heliopolis (Thebes).” The original contents may have included coronation regalia. Dynasty 18, reign of Tutankhamun 1332–1322 BCE
